Kurkuma es un Restaurante familiar de cocina Hindú situado cerca del mar en un pueblo costero llamado Calella (Barcelona). Ofrecemos la oportunidad para explorar diversos platos de diferentes lugares de la India bajo un mismo techo. Kurkuma es la esencia en la mayoría de los platos de la India que agrega sabor y color a los alimentos. El Kurkuma también tiene propiedades medicinales y por lo tanto hace que los alimentos sean más saludables. En resumen, KURKUMA representa comida sana y sabrosa. Nosotros provenimos de Punjab situado en el norte de la India, pero nuestra cocina se nutre de platos y sabores de todos los rincones del país y queremos compartir con vosotros lo que nos apasiona.
